The City Of Estevan released a media release on snow removal as follows:

Winter has arrived, which means snow removal needs to be addressed.In an effort to keep our City sidewalks clean and safe for pedestrian use, we ask that you please attend to removing any snow / ice from the sidewalk in front of your residence including corner lot properties, within twenty-four hours of snow.

 

Please be advised of City of Estevan Bylaw 2016-1963 Section 53(3):

“The occupier of property in the City of Estevan shall remove any snow, ice or other obstruction from the public sidewalk adjacent to such property within twenty-four hours of the time such snow, ice or other obstruction appears on such public sidewalk. In the event that this subsection is not complied with, the City may remove such snow, ice or other obstruction at the expense of such occupant or owner, and in the event of the non-payment of such expense, such expense may be charged against the property as a special assessment to be recovered in like manner as and with the taxes”.

 

And City of Estevan Bylaw 2016-1963 Section 53(2):

“No person shall deposit any substance on any highway, public sidewalk, boulevard or ditch within the City of Estevan”. This includes shoveling or snow blowing snow from your property onto the City street, sidewalk or boulevard.
